Do China passport holders need a visa to visit Japan?
Yes, you need a visa. Chinese citizens require a visa to enter Japan. Apply through a designated agent at the Japanese embassy or consulate; the standard single-entry tourist visa allows up to 15 days.

/02 — The process
How to apply
/01
Choose a designated agent
Mainland Chinese applicants cannot apply directly. Submit via an embassy-approved travel agency in your jurisdiction.
· ~150 agencies· by city
/02
Gather required materials
Passport, photos, application form, itinerary, hotel + flight bookings, and financial proof.
· 12 documents· see checklist
/03
Submit application
Agent reviews materials and submits to your jurisdiction's consulate (Beijing / Shanghai / Guangzhou / Chongqing / Shenyang).
· in-person· no biometrics
/04
Collect passport
Pickup at the agency once issued. Verify dates and entry count before leaving.
· 4–7 days· track via agent

/06 — The risks
Common refusal reasons
by frequency
/01
Insufficient financial proof
Bank balance too low, or sudden large deposits before applying.
32%
/02
Weak ties to home country
No stable employment, no property, single applicant under 30 with limited history.
24%
/03
Inconsistent itinerary
Hotel dates don't match flights, or itinerary lacks detail.
14%
/04
Incomplete documents
Missing pages from hukou, expired employment certificate.
12%
/05
Previous overstay
Any prior overstay anywhere — flagged in Japan's records.
Recent visits to certain countries trigger additional review.
4%
/07 — On arrival
After you land
/01
Customs
Declare cash over JPY 1,000,000 equivalent and avoid bringing restricted fresh food, meat, plants, or controlled medicines.
/02
Immigration
Fingerprints and a photo are normally collected on arrival. Visit Japan Web can speed up immigration and customs forms.
/03
Connectivity
Tourist SIMs, eSIMs, and pocket WiFi rentals are widely available at Narita, Haneda, Kansai, and major city pickup points.

Can I apply for a Japan visa on arrival?—
No. Mainland Chinese passport holders cannot obtain a visa on arrival in Japan. Application must be completed and approved before boarding your flight.
